Feb 28, 2023 · There has been speculation lately that the U.S. dollar is on the verge of a major decline and might even lose its status as the world's major reserve currency. "De-dollarization," or the movement away from using the U.S. dollar as the primary currency of exchange in global trade and investment, has become a hot topic in financial publications.

Sep 20, 2023 · Sept. 20, 2023, at 3:09 p.m. 7. Falling real wages. In a period of stagnant wage growth, devaluation can cause a fall in real wages. This is because devaluation causes inflation, but if the inflation rate is higher than wage increases, then real wages will fall. Evaluation of a devaluation. A diversified portfolio is a collection of investments in various assets that seeks to earn the highest plausible return while reducing likely risks. A typical diversified portfolio has a mixture of stocks, fixed income, and commodities. Diversification works because these assets react differently to the same ...
